Class Central is learner-supported. When you buy through links on our site, we may earn an affiliate commission.

YouTube

How to Create Complete Food Delivery App Using React JS - Step by Step Tutorial

GreatStack via YouTube

Overview

Coursera Flash Sale
40% Off Coursera Plus for 3 Months!
Grab it
Learn to build a complete food delivery web application from scratch using React JS in this comprehensive step-by-step tutorial. Master the fundamentals of React development while creating a fully functional food ordering platform that includes a home page with menu display, shopping cart functionality, order placement system, and user authentication with sign-in and sign-up capabilities. Start by setting up the React project environment and creating a responsive navigation bar, then progress through building essential pages and implementing React Router for seamless navigation. Develop key components including an attractive website header, interactive menu items display, dynamic food list with filtering capabilities, and a professional footer section. Focus on responsive design principles to ensure the application works flawlessly across all devices and screen sizes. Implement user authentication through a modal-based sign-in and sign-up system, create a comprehensive shopping cart page with item management features, and build a complete order placement interface. Gain hands-on experience with React hooks, state management, component architecture, and modern JavaScript ES6+ features while following industry best practices for code organization and structure. Access provided source code, downloadable assets, and additional learning resources to reinforce your understanding and continue your React development journey.

Syllabus

00:00 Project Overview
06:39 React Project Setup
11:53 Create navigation bar
30:55 Create Pages
33:47 Setup React Router
37:13 Create Website Header
46:17 Create Menu Items
01:02:42 Create Food List component
01:45:39 Create Footer
01:58:50 Create Add Download component
02:04:38 Make the website responsive
02:15:03 Create Sign in / Sign up Component
02:35:34 Create Cart Page
03:09:42 Create Place order page

Taught by

GreatStack

Reviews

Start your review of How to Create Complete Food Delivery App Using React JS - Step by Step Tutorial

Never Stop Learning.

Get personalized course recommendations, track subjects and courses with reminders, and more.

Someone learning on their laptop while sitting on the floor.